Benaiah Sawyers letter to Richard Pell Hunt
Benaiah Sawyers
Richard Pell Hunt, 1797-1856
06/28/1828
On right of sheet:
" New York June 28th 1828
Rich'd P. Hunt
Respected Friend
I have most unaccountably neglected the within note [illegible] this time when due has past, not recollecting that it was made at so early a date - I now hand it to thee wishing thee to procure the payment & hold the funds till a convenient opportunity to send to me after paying thyself for they expenses & troubles I [illegible] they assured friend Benaiah Sawyer"
On left of sheet:
"B. Sawyer Letter 6 mo 28th 1828"
"Rich'd P. Hunt Waterloo Seneca Co. N.Y."
Postmarked in red ink "NEW-YORK [illegible date]"
Random computations in black ink
